Knowing Your Brake Rotors
Brake rotors can be vented, slotted, or solid, depending on the specific model and year of the Dodge Ram. They experience wear due to consistent friction with the brake pads. Signs that your brake rotors might require to be replaced consist of:
Pulsation or vibration throughout brakingWarping of the rotorGrooves or scoring visible on the surface area
Appropriate maintenance of brake rotors includes cleaning and checking them frequently. Resurfacing rotors can extend their life, but if they're too thin, replacement is essential.

Brake lines are accountable for transporting brake fluid to calipers under pressure. Ensuring that these lines remain in great condition is vital. Indications of wear may include:
Visible leaksCracked or bulging lines
Brake fluid itself must also be kept an eye on. It soaks up wetness over time, which can lead to brake failure. The fluid ought to be changed at routine intervals, normally every 2 years, to preserve braking effectiveness.

Can I replace brake parts myself?
Yes, many Dodge Ram owners perform their own brake upkeep. However, it requires fundamental mechanical abilities, appropriate tools, and safety preventative measures.
What type of brake pads are best for my Dodge Ram?
This depends on your driving style. Ceramic pads are quieter and produce less dust, making them appropriate for everyday driving. Metallic pads offer much better efficiency but may use out rotors much faster.
Is it necessary to replace rotors with pads?
Not always, but if rotors are worn, deformed, or harmed, they ought to be changed or resurfaced at the very same time as brake pads for optimum performance.
How typically should I check my brake fluid?
Brake fluid ought to be inspected regularly, usually every oil change, and changed every two years to ensure effective braking.
What should I do if I discover a brake fluid leak?
If you observe a brake fluid leakage, it's vital to resolve it immediately. Brake fluid leakages can significantly impair braking performance and should be examined and repaired by a qualified mechanic.
